WebRBCS Package — MITgcm checkpoint68o-6-gab47de63d documentation. 8.3.2. RBCS Package ¶. 8.3.2.1. Introduction ¶. pkg/rbcs provides the flexibility to relax fields (temperature, salinity, ptracers, horizontal velocities) in any 3-D location, thus can be used to implement a sponge layer, or a “source” anywhere in the domain, among other uses.
